Results from Deed Tax Transfer Poll for Kings County

Community Local News

The Municipality of The County of Kings is considering implementing a Deed Tax Transfer. 

Currently Kings is the only county who does not have one in all of Nova Scotia. 

On September 4th I posted a poll looking for feedback from residents, these results are from this morning, September 16th and are as follows! 

There were 2,205 votes in total about the Deed Tax Transfer (DTT) with lots of questions, concerns and conversation. 

The question was as follows “Do you agree with the County of Kings implementing a Deed Tax Transfer?”

88% feel a DTT is not necessary, 8% need to learn more & 4% feel a DTT is necessary. 

⚠️ Please Note: 

Approximately 60% of my followers on this page reside in the County of Kings, these stats may not be completely accurate but with a deep analysis the majority of those who voted are Kings County residents.
